Real-Life Communication -- Solution

Medical electronics salesperson Heather Phillips says her company recognizes the need to communicate differently to different audiences. It designs different pamphlets for different clients. "For administration, you go in and talk about serviceability, upgradability and financing. With radiologists, you touch on the technical. What are the clinical applications of the system?" she says.

Technicians

This unit is designed to be easy to use, quick and accurate. Your patients won't have to wait for several minutes while you adjust settings. It has conveniently placed handles, quick release locks and a sturdy hand switch.

It also has a preprogrammed service diagnostic, so if you do have any problems you can solve them yourself. We've built it around a maintenance free battery that can handle 50 exposures before it needs recharging. And it fully recharges overnight. You'll find more detailed information in these pamphlets. Please feel free to look them over and ask me any questions.

Administration

This unit will expand the services you can provide to your patients. It's an investment for your hospital. It's mobile but can take the quality X-rays usually limited to stationary machines.

The AM-4 requires fewer retakes than other systems out there -- that saves time and money. The unit has a preprogrammed "help" function which enables technicians to do any troubleshooting in-house. Anything they can't solve can be handled through our service center, opened 24 hours, 365 days of the year.

We do have flexible financing packages available. Take a look through this brochure and let me know if you'd like an in-house demonstration.

After your presentation, the technicians are interested. The administrators are non-committal. That's OK. You know it can take several months to close a sale! You'll contact the hospital in two weeks about setting up an in-house demonstration.
